An aquifer is of 2 types - unconfined and confined aquifers. It can be defined as a body of permeable rock which can contain groundwater.

Confined aquifers have an impermeable rock layer that prevents water from seeping into the aquifer from the ground surface. So, this aquifer is present between the rocks layer that are impermeable.
